Checklist item 7 — HSM delivery, Varnell run

The Corveil-9 hardware security module ships tomorrow from the Ashgate lab to the Varnell data hall. It travels in the tamper-evident orange case, strapped upright, never stacked under other cargo. Driver must keep the vehicle attended at all times; no meal stops on this leg. Confirm the case seal number against the manifest before departure and again on arrival. Route deviations require a call to the coordinator first. At the dock, apply the hand-over instruction noted below.

handover note for yagef-bagep: the drudor pelius courier leaves the kasdor zorvan norir ledger at gate 8016 under passcode 755406

Maintainers should understand that roles are resolved at login by the Gatewright sidecar, which maps group claims to wiki capabilities (read, edit, admin, space-admin). If a user reports missing edit rights, first confirm their group sync timestamp is under one hour old, then check whether the role map was redeployed recently — stale maps are the usual culprit. Never grant space-admin directly; use the escalation group instead. The role resolver currently runs with the values listed below.

service settings:
PRAWYN_PIN=9848
PRAWYN_METRICS_HOST=metrics.prawyn.lumicworks.corp
PRAWYN_LOG_LEVEL=warn
PRAWYN_TENANT=pelius

- [ ] Step 7: Archive cold storage buckets (Glacierline tier). Confirm both ceremony witnesses are present, verify bucket manifests match the Oxbow ledger, then seal the archive key shares. Plugin authors may observe but not handle shares. Once sealed, the archive index itself is encrypted and can only be reopened with the passphrase below.

vault phrase of badup-hahig = tamael-aldael-kelmir-istael-fenok-istwyn-tamius-jorath-oliion